Praise the Lord! We are a group of Pentecostal believers who believe in the death, burial, and resurrection of Jesus Christ. We believe in repentance, baptism in the name of Jesus Christ for the remission of sins, receiving the gift of the Holy Ghost evidenced by the speaking in other tongues as the Holy Spirit gives utterance, and living a holy victorious lifestyle evidenced by the love that we have toward God and one another. Please feel welcome to worship with us.

Just one point here, well not so little, Jesus did NOT die on a cross but rather an upright stake (Grk Stauros) or upright pole ! Remember what the Bible says that we MUST worship God "with spirit and with TRUTH" !
Matthew ch 27 verse 42 He saved others; himself he cannot save. If he be the King of Israel, let him now come down from the cross, and we will believe him. I agree with your statement. The word “cross” that is used in Scripture means a pole to be placed in the ground and used for capital punishment. Our generalized post-modern 21st century concept of the “cross” is different than the concept of the cross 2,000 years ago. Using the word “cross” would not be an error unless we are associating it with the “t” shape that many have acknowledged it as. - Minister James M. Pope
